摘要
This paper proposes a robust feature matching for slant SAR images based on differentially constrained RANSAC. Firstly, we obtain a set of initial matches provided by SAR-SIFT operator. Then, we set a differentially constrained model with strong constraint in the azimuth direction and no constraint in the distance direction. We use the nearest neighbor contrast (NNC) and the distance offset definition (DOD) techniques to eliminate outliers with large distance distortion. Experiments are carried out on Chinese spaceborne and airborne SAR images. The results show that the proposed method has excellent performance in accuracy, distribution and efficiency, and is suitable for matching SAR images covering areas with large terrain fluctuations such as mountainous areas.
